function resetBorder(inputTag) {
	inputTag.style.border = "solid #666 1px";
}

function checkForm() {
	if (!document.getElementById('antwortA').checked && !document.getElementById('antwortB').checked && !document.getElementById('antwortC').checked){
		alert("Bitte geben Sie eine Lösungsantwort an!");
		return false;
	}
	
	if (document.gewinnspiel.name.value.length < 2){
		alert("Bitte geben Sie Ihren Namen an!");
		document.gewinnspiel.name.style.border = "solid #ffcc01 1px";
		document.gewinnspiel.name.focus();
		return false;
	}
	if (document.gewinnspiel.strasse.value.length < 2){
		alert("Bitte geben Sie Ihre Straße an!");
		document.gewinnspiel.strasse.style.border = "solid #ffcc01 1px";
		document.gewinnspiel.strasse.focus();
		return false;
	}
	if (document.gewinnspiel.haus.value.length < 1){
		alert("Bitte geben Sie Ihre Hausnummer an!");
		document.gewinnspiel.haus.style.border = "solid #ffcc01 1px";
		document.gewinnspiel.haus.focus();
		return false;
	}
	if (document.gewinnspiel.plz.value.length < 5){
		alert("Bitte geben Sie Ihre Postleitzahl an!");
		document.gewinnspiel.plz.style.border = "solid #ffcc01 1px";
		document.gewinnspiel.plz.focus();
		return false;
	}	
	if (document.gewinnspiel.ort.value.length < 2){
		alert("Bitte geben Sie Ihre Wohnort an!");
		document.gewinnspiel.ort.style.border = "solid #ffcc01 1px";
		document.gewinnspiel.ort.focus();
		return false;
	}	
	if (document.gewinnspiel.newsletter.checked){
		var filter = /^([a-zA-Z0-9_\.\-])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;
		if (!filter.test(document.gewinnspiel.email.value)) {
			alert("Bitte geben Sie Ihre E-Mail Adresse an, um unseren Newsletter zu erhalten!");
			document.gewinnspiel.email.style.border = "solid #ffcc01 1px";
			document.gewinnspiel.email.focus();
			return false;
		}
	}
	if (document.gewinnspiel.bedingungen.checked == false){
		alert("Sie müssen den Teilnahmebedingungen zustimmen!");
		return false;
	}	
}